Frequently Asked Questions About Electrician Services in Monterey
Do I need a permit for electrical work in Monterey?
Yes, most significant electrical work, such as panel upgrades, rewiring, or installing new circuits, will require a permit from the City of Monterey’s building department. Licensed electricians are familiar with these requirements and can assist you in obtaining the necessary permits, ensuring your work is compliant with local regulations.
How often should I have my electrical system inspected in my Monterey home?
It’s generally recommended to have your home’s electrical system inspected every 3-5 years. However, if you live in an older home, have recently made major renovations, or have moved into a new property, a prompt inspection is wise. Given the coastal environment, periodic checks can also help identify any potential issues caused by moisture or salt air.
What are the signs of outdated or dangerous wiring?
Signs of outdated or dangerous wiring can include flickering lights, outlets that are warm to the touch, frequently tripping circuit breakers, the smell of burning plastic, or a buzzing sound coming from outlets or switches. If you notice any of these issues, it’s crucial to contact a qualified electrician in Monterey immediately to assess the situation and prevent potential hazards like electrical fires.

Local Electrical Age Data for Monterey
The median home in Monterey was built in 1969 — placing most of the area's housing stock in the possible aluminum branch wiring era. Aluminum branch-circuit wiring was widely installed in homes built during the 1965–1973 period as a cost-saving alternative to copper. Aluminum expands and contracts more than copper, loosening connections over time and creating arc-fault fire hazards. Affected homes require either full rewiring or approved remediation at every device (AFCI breakers or CO/ALR-rated outlets and switches). Source: U.S. Census Bureau, American Community Survey, median year structure built.

California Electricity Rates & Electrical Upgrades
California residents pay an average of 32.5¢/kWh for residential electricity (2025) — above the national average. At this rate, a modern panel upgrade that enables whole-home efficiency improvements (heat pump HVAC, EV charging, solar-ready wiring) has a stronger economic case than in lower-rate states. Source: U.S. Energy Information Administration, Electric Power Monthly, 2025.
